DEPARTMENT OF ENERGY
DESIGNATION ORDER NO.00-03.00A
TO THE GENERAL COUNSEL
DESIGNATION. Under the authority vested in me as Secretary of Energy and by
Executive Order 12866, you are hereby designated the Department's Regulatory Policy
Officer, as that title and its responsibilities are described in the Executive Order.
RESCISSION. DOE Designation Order No. 00-03.00 is hereby rescinded.
LIMITATION.
3.1 This designation covers all parts of the Department of Energy, except the
Federal Energy Regulatory Commission.
3.2 In exercising the designated authority in this Order, a designee shall be
governed by the rules and regulations of DOE and the policies and procedures
prescribed by the Secretary or Deputy Secretary.
AUTHORITY TO REDESIGNATE. This designation may not be redesignated.
DURATION AND EFFECTIVE DATE.
5.1 All actions pursuant to any authority provided prior to this Order or pursuant to
any authority granted by this Order taken prior to and in effect on the date of
this Order are ratified and remain in force as if taken under this Order, unless or
until rescinded, amended or superseded.
5.2 A copy of this Designation Order shall be provided to DOE's Office of
Management, which manages the Secretarial Delegations of Authority System.
